Reaching for the Stars: Evolution of Satellite Internet Technology
Early efforts in satellite technology were fraught with challenges. Bulky equipment and high latency undermined the efficiency of data transfer, resulting in sluggish performance. Due to the distance signals had to travel from the earth to the satellite and back, even a simple click could take seconds to register, frustrating users who had grown accustomed to the rapidity of terrestrial broadband.
Advancements in satellite technology have dramatically altered this landscape. No longer constrained by the limitations of early systems, modern satellite internet harnesses the power of high-frequency bands for data transmission. The result? Enhanced speed and reliable service that rivals, and at times surpasses, traditional land-based internet offerings.

The Challenge of Providing Internet Service to Remote Areas
Traditionally, geographical and logistical barriers have made it challenging to extend broadband internet services to rural communities. These areas are typically characterized by lower population densities, which leads to higher costs per customer for laying down fiber or cable networks compared to urban areas.

Beyond Boundaries: HughesNet Gen4 and Gen5 Services
Advancements in HughesNet services are evident with the launch of Gen4 and Gen5, representing significant leaps forward. Unlike their predecessors, these generations offer enhanced performance, increased download capacities, and improved browsing experiences. Unleashing speeds that redefine the capabilities of satellite internet, Gen5, in particular, harnesses the power of the EchoStar XVII and EchoStar XIX satellites. This capability results in greater efficiency and the ability to support a greater number of customers with higher data demands.
The inauguration of Gen4 and Gen5 curated a new chapter for smart data plans characterized by more data capacity and flexibility. Customers benefit from data-saving features, which stretch monthly allowances further, while delivering continuous service at reduced speeds, even after plan data has been exceeded—a stark contrast to the days of stringent data limits and steep overage charges.

Tracing the Roots: Hughes Aircraft and the Origins of HughesNet
From Aerospace to Internet: The Legacy of Hughes Aircraft
The journey of HughesNet, a prominent satellite internet service provider, traces back to the esteemed legacy of Hughes Aircraft Company. Established in 1932 by the visionary Howard Hughes, this aerospace and defense contractor carved its spot in history through remarkable innovations and contributions to aviation and space exploration. Hughes Aircraft's profound expertise in satellite technologies laid the groundwork for what would eventually evolve into HughesNet Satellite Internet.

Data Caps and Unlimited Data: The Balancing Act
Understanding the importance of ample data for its users, HughesNet has worked toward providing plans that balance the need for data volume with the inherent limitations of satellite-based services. Although unlimited data plans remain elusive in the satellite industry due to bandwidth constraints, HughesNet has introduced service options with higher data allowances and implemented programs like the Bonus Zone, offering additional bandwidth during off-peak hours.
